Chutespeak/Treespeak 

The Le-Matoran of Metru Nui have two names for the slang that they use, which is also known to outsiders on rare occasions. "Chutespeak" was the name given to it on Metru Nui, while on Mata Nui it was called "Treespeak". This type of slang involves combining two or more words into one, in a similar way to the Anglo-Saxon practice of kenning in the real world.
